Greg Thomas - General Manager

Greg began working with Sterland Computing in April 2003 bringing with him over 20 years experience in information technology (IT).

Greg began his career as a program analyst spending six years in development, design and project management. He quickly progressed into an IT Management position, gaining valuable insight and experience in small to medium enterprises. Greg then moved into a vendor environment with Progress Software allowing him to build a solid business development understanding, with a focus on the consulting and services field. A promotion to Services Manager Australia, then to Services Director Asia Pacific cemented Greg’s career and capabilities in this area.

Greg has a Masters Degree in Computing Science together with a number of professional business and technology qualifications.

Chris Johnston - Product Manager

With over 11 years experience working in the building supplies industry Chris joined Sterland Computing in January 2000. He brought with him experience in analysing business requirements and the design and application of software to meet specific business needs.

Chris’ extensive industry and product knowledge has been utilised through our support desk, training, consulting and in the design and development of the ProStix solution. As the Product Manager for Sterland Computing, Chris is responsible for approving the direction and quality of improvements within the ProStix suite.

Warren Castles - Services Delivery Manager 

Warren has been with Sterland Computing since July 1997 and has recently stepped into the role of Services Delivery Manager. Prior to that, Warren was a senior analyst responsible for services software development and co-leadership of the development team. Warren has been directly involved in software design, development and implementation for over 20 years.

He began his career in 1987 as a programmer and immediately began working with enterprise software solutions for distribution companies and membership organisations. Over the next 10 years - while developing his skills in all facets of the development life cycle, he also developed the technical skills required to deploy hardware and operating systems. Since joining Sterland Computing Warren has helped lead the development team in continually setting & reviewing standards, mentoring, managing the development life cycle, managing database standards & design and also assisting with technical support. He has worked closely with many of our customers over the past 10 years to analyse their business needs & translate them into effective solutions. 

David Morris - Development Manager

David has been with Sterland Computing since October 2006. He started with us as a senior analyst until his recent promotion to Development Manager. With over 15 years experience in IT, starting as an analyst programmer, David moved into a senior software engineering position and project management at QAD. Here he played a pivotal role in global development projects and David was instrumental in improving the development processes and advancing product quality without compromising project budgets.

Along with his role as project manager and looking after the research and development team in Australia, David completed his Masters in Business Administration - majoring in Information Technology. David’s experience expands to automotive, medical, electronics and industrial and consumer packaged goods in the manufacturing sector. This allows him to cater for industry specific requirements and various compliance regulations.

Bernie Pannell - Technical Manager

Bernie celebrated 10 years with Sterland Computing in 2007, having joined the company in June 1997. As our Technical Manager he looks after all technical aspects of integration of Sterland’s suite of products. Bernie works closely with our clients, their hardware vendors and networking support. In addition, Bernie also works with Sterland’s internal Product Development & Support teams, along with Progress Software - the development language and relational database product used to develop the ProStix suite. 

Bernie has worked in IT for almost 20 years and has accumulated a number of industry recognised certifications, including Progress, AIX, Citrix, Red Hat & Microsoft. He graduated in 2008 from Charles Sturt University with a Master of Networking & System Administration and an MCSE.
